3. Indie Lee CoQ toner - I like this, but it isn't necessary in my routine. If you are using lighter moisturising products, or have used a stronger acid - this can be quite nice. It takes the edge off the acid, and can be a nice base layer for another hydrating product.
4. January Labs Balancing lotion - It has been a while since I used this. I believe I first tried it when it was much cooler, I was a bit meh. But I like it much better today. It is light and non greasy. I think oily skins will quite like this. If your skin is dry, I would combine it with an oil or layer it with an oily serum (like Zelens Vit D - see spoiler).
Random note - Although my skin is oily, I incorporate a little oil (even just 2 drops) in my AM and PM routine almost daily.
5. Farmacy Eye Dew - this is a nice eye cream. It is "good", but not "great" on me. My favourite is the Tata Harper Restorative Eye cream which I have repurchased many times. It is also in the Cult Box. I didn't repurchase after I ran out the last time because I wanted to get through some of my other eye products that were piling up.

I think the Cult Box is entirely worth it - IF you will find these products useful in your routine. The box contains some of my HG products, and others I quite like.
I am not sure yet if I plan to get it, for 2 reasons.
1. My Zelens Vit D bottle still has a lot of product in it, and I don't go through it quickly. It is very beneficial for stressed out skin, but if you have normal healthy skin (and have a pretty robust skincare regimen) - you may not find you need such a spendy product daily. Hence I go through it slowly. So I'm not sure I want a full bottle as a back up...it will be a while before I get to it.
2. The Indie Lee toner - I have a lot of product still left. This product is actually the most "take it or leave it" of the box. It is nice and all, but not necessary in my routine (I have other hydrating spritzes that I love).
In this box the discount is good, and I won't be wasting any of the products, but I might have to store a couple for a while. Dunno.
Totally agree with @greenchilli comments @lauriebos but wanted to add that the vit D drops are excellent paired with very active serums if you have more sensitive skin. I mix the D with the zelens intense defense antioxidant serum or retinol which my skin couldn't tolerate otherwise. I am just about to open my fourth bottle since it came out last year.
